This PR adds Petalgate, our new feature-flag rollout framework for the Marrow platform. Flags can now ramp gradually by cohort instead of the all-or-nothing toggles we had before. Rollbacks are one config push, so release days should be calmer. Defaults are conservative on purpose. The initial tuning constants for ramp behavior are listed below.

constants for fajop-tahaf:
RATE_LIMITS = {
    "holael": 2,
    "oliael": 10,
    "druael": 10,
    "wenwyn": 10,
}

Deals between 250 and 500 seats cap at 12% without escalation. This replaces the interim guidance issued after the Hallowick account renewal. Margin erosion in the enterprise segment has run ahead of plan for two consecutive quarters, and this policy is our primary corrective lever. Please ensure sales leads are briefed before month-end. The note below covers the confidential rationale behind these thresholds.

Regards,
Delia Varn, CFO, Brontelle Software

board note of kageg-bahof: The renewal with Holwynax Holdings closes at $2 million a year, 5 percent below the last contract. Project Ulaath slips by two quarters because of the supplier delay.

# Break-Glass Access — Query Planner Patch

Scope: emergency deploy path for the Thornfield API's GraphQL N+1 fix. The batching resolver (DataLoom layer) eliminated per-row lookups on the `orders.items` field; break-glass exists solely to hotfix regressions in that resolver. Access requires two approvers from the Kestrel rotation, auto-expires in 60 minutes, and every session is recorded. Reviewer note: no standing credentials remain after the Marrow audit. To open the break-glass vault, enter the recovery passphrase stated below.

unlock words, fafop-hawep: briwyn-oliix-sorox

# FuelTally fleet reporting — plugin author environment reference.
# This file configures the nightly fuel-usage aggregation run for the Dremmond
# Haulage fleet. Plugins receive REPORT_PERIOD (days), UNIT_SYSTEM (metric or
# imperial), and DEPOT_FILTER as read-only inputs. Do not write to the staging
# bucket directly; use the exporter hook instead. Output format defaults to CSV
# unless PLUGIN_FORMAT overrides it. The exporter also needs the telematics
# gateway credential, which is set on the line immediately following this block.

env line for fafof-fahag: LEDGER_TOKEN5=f8790